Strategic context and market positioning

  • Will be the only cobalt sulfate refinery in North America, addressing a critical midstream gap in the battery supply chain.

  • Upon commissioning, will represent 100% of North American cobalt sulfate refining capacity, with plans to expand to 6,500 tonnes annually.

  • Production will account for approximately 27% of the ex-China market share for cobalt sulfate.

  • Supported by $48M in U.S. and Canadian government funding and fully permitted for a 5,120 tpa facility.

  • Strategic partnerships and tolling agreements secure feedstock and commercial offtake, including a long-term deal with LG Energy Solution for 60% of production.

Project execution and financials

  • Construction budget of $73M is fully funded, with mechanical completion targeted for Q2 2027 and commercial production in Q4 2027.

  • Major equipment has been procured, and project controls are in place to manage costs and execution.

  • Additional $15M allocated for commissioning, ramp-up, and initial working capital, expected to be managed through available liquidity.

  • EBITDA projected to reach $30–35M at steady-state, with gross conversion margins largely independent of cobalt price due to tolling structure.

  • Expansion to 6,500 tonnes expected in years 2–3, leveraging crystallizer optimization.

Platform expansion and growth opportunities

  • Plans to expand refining capabilities to include nickel sulfate and cobalt metal production.

  • Recycling initiatives include a joint venture with Indigenous partners to process battery waste into black mass for refining.

  • Demonstrated first North American recovery of nickel-cobalt MHP and technical-grade lithium carbonate from recycled batteries.

  • Completed engineering studies for commercial-scale recycling and nickel sulfate refining, with potential for U.S.-based expansion.

  • Idaho Cobalt-Copper properties provide strategic upstream optionality, with ongoing exploration and resource expansion.
